What is difference between: kill, murder and assassinate?

Kill-this can be used to talk about the cause of death of a person or any other living thing. This can be intentional or unintentional.

  • He killed the spider in the bathroom.
  • The woman was killed in a hit and run accident.
  • The lion hunted and killed the zebra.

 
Murder-this is used to talk the intentional cause of death of another human being.

  • The police think she murdered her husband.
  • He said he will murder me if I don’t give him the money.
  • They were murdered by they’re neighbour, he shot them all.

 
Assassinate-this is the murder of an important or prominent person like a president or a political activist for religious or political reasons.

  • There are plans to assassinate the president.
  • John F. Kennedy was assassinated in Texas, he was shot twice.
  • The assassination of Malcolm X occurred in 1965, he was shot 16 times.
